दिलचस्प पोस्ट
फ़ंक्शन को सशर्त रूप से लागू करें मैं वर्तमान में कार्यान्वित फ़ाइल का पथ और नाम कैसे प्राप्त करूं? PHP में स्ट्रिंग लम्बाई की जांच करें आईओएस में एक छोटी आवाज़ खेलें एक्शनबार के होम आइकन और शीर्षक के बीच पैडिंग PHP स्क्रिप्ट को बाढ़ से रोकें Visual Studio 2010 द्वारा .NET Framework 4.5 लक्ष्यीकरण बैकबोन: `$` ('# पादलेख') “ एल `को क्यों असाइन करें? मैं स्ट्रिंग संसाधन से अलर्ट डीआलाओग में क्लिक करने योग्य हाइपरलिंक्स कैसे प्राप्त करूं? मैं Python के urllib (2) को किसी रीडायरेक्ट के बाद से कैसे रोकूं? स्ट्रिंग स्ट्रीम क्यों विफलता पर लक्ष्य का मूल्य बदलता है? जब / कैसे लिनक्स लोड पते पुस्तकालयों में पता स्थान में है? सप्ताह के पहले दिन NSCalendar ब्लूटूथ हेडसेट के साथ Android RecognizerIntent का उपयोग करना फ़ाइल आकार के मानव पठनीय संस्करण प्राप्त करने के लिए पुन: प्रयोज्य लायब्रेरी?

Tablix: प्रत्येक पृष्ठ पर हेडर पंक्तियों को दोहराएं नहीं – रिपोर्ट बिल्डर 3.0

मेरे पास बहुत सारी पंक्तियों के साथ एक टैब्लेक्स है जो कई पृष्ठों पर फैला हुआ है। मैंने प्रत्येक पृष्ठ पर Tablix संपत्ति दोहराएँ हैडर पंक्तियां सेट की है लेकिन यह काम नहीं करता है मैंने कहीं पढ़ा है कि रिपोर्ट बिल्डर 3.0 में यह एक ज्ञात बग है। क्या ये सच है? यदि नहीं, तो क्या कुछ और करने की आवश्यकता है?

Solutions Collecting From Web of "Tablix: प्रत्येक पृष्ठ पर हेडर पंक्तियों को दोहराएं नहीं – रिपोर्ट बिल्डर 3.0"

यह आपके द्वारा उपयोग किए जा रहे टेब्लेक्स संरचना पर निर्भर करता है। एक तालिका में, उदाहरण के लिए, आपके पास कॉलम समूह नहीं हैं, इसलिए रिपोर्टिंग सेवा यह नहीं पहचानती कि कौन से टेक्स्ट बॉक्स कॉलम हेडर हैं और ट्रिपेट कॉलम हेडर्स की संपत्ति True को काम करने के लिए काम नहीं कर रहा है।

इसके बजाय, आपको निम्न करने की आवश्यकता है:

  1. समूहिंग फलक में उन्नत मोड खोलें। (स्तंभ समूहों के दाईं ओर तीर पर क्लिक करें और उन्नत मोड का चयन करें।)
    • स्क्रीनशॉट
  2. रो समूह क्षेत्र (स्तंभ समूह नहीं) में, एक स्थिर समूह पर क्लिक करें, जो टैब्लिकिक्स में संबंधित टेक्स्टबॉक्स को उजागर करती है। प्रत्येक स्टेटिक समूह के माध्यम से क्लिक करें, जब तक कि बाएं कॉलम शीर्षलेख को हाइलाइट नहीं किया जाता। यह आमतौर पर सूचीबद्ध पहला स्टेटिक समूह है
  3. प्रॉपर्टी विंडो में, RepeatOnNewPage संपत्ति को True पर सेट करें
    • स्क्रीनशॉट
  4. सुनिश्चित करें कि KeepWithGroup संपत्ति को After सेट किया गया है।

KeepWithGroup संपत्ति निर्दिष्ट करती है कि कौन सा समूह स्थिर सदस्य को छड़ी करने की आवश्यकता है यदि After सेट किया जाता है, तो स्थैतिक सदस्य इसके बाद के समूह के साथ चिपकाता है, या उसके नीचे, समूह शीर्षलेख के रूप में कार्य करना यदि Before सेट किया गया है, तो स्थैतिक सदस्य ग्रुप पाद लेख के रूप में कार्य करने से पहले, या इसके बाद के समूह के साथ चिपक जाता है। यदि None सेट None , रिपोर्टिंग सेवाएं निर्धारित करती है कि स्थैतिक सदस्य कहां दें।

अब जब आप रिपोर्ट देखते हैं, तो स्तंभ हेडर टेब्लेक्स के प्रत्येक पृष्ठ पर दोहराते हैं।

यह वीडियो दिखाता है कि यह कैसे ठीक से वर्णित उत्तर के रूप में सेट करना है।

मेरे पास 2.0 है और ऊपर मदद करने के लिए मिला; हालांकि, एक स्थिर का चयन किसी कारण के लिए सेल को उजागर नहीं करता है मैंने इन चरणों का पालन किया:

  1. स्तंभ समूहों के तहत उन्नत का चयन करें और स्थिति को दिखाएगा
  2. स्थिर समूहों पर क्लिक करें जो पंक्ति समूहों में दिखाई देता है
  3. KeepWithGroup को बाद में सेट करें और दोहराएं

अब आपके कॉलम हेडर को प्रत्येक पृष्ठ पर दोहराना चाहिए।

इसे पूरा करने का एक और तरीका यदि आपके पास अभी भी यह समस्या है, तो निम्न कार्य कर रहा है:

  • सभी तालिका शीर्षक पाठ को रिक्त छोड़ दें।
  • रिपोर्ट "हैडर" अनुभाग में आयत के अंदर टेक्स्ट बॉक्स जोड़ते हैं, प्रत्येक पाठ बॉक्स तालिका के लिए एक कॉलम हैडर का प्रतिनिधित्व करेंगे।
  • चूंकि यह आयत रिपोर्ट हैडर अनुभाग पर है, यह सभी रिपोर्ट पृष्ठों पर प्रदर्शित होगा।

धन्यवाद, सूफ़ियन

समूहिंग फलक में Advanced Mode खोलें। (स्तंभ समूहों के दाईं ओर तीर पर क्लिक करें और उन्नत मोड का चयन करें।)

रो समूह क्षेत्र (स्तंभ समूह नहीं) में, एक स्थिर समूह पर क्लिक करें, जो टैब्लिकिक्स में इसी टेक्स्टबॉक्स पर प्रकाश डाला है।

प्रत्येक स्टेटिक समूह के माध्यम से क्लिक करें, जब तक कि बाएं कॉलम शीर्षलेख को हाइलाइट नहीं किया जाता। यह आमतौर पर सूचीबद्ध पहला स्टेटिक समूह है

गुण ग्रिड में:

  • KeepWithGroup को After सेट करें
  • पुनरावृत्त शीर्षकों के लिए दोहराने के लिए RepeatOnNewPage सेट करें
  • हेडर्स को दृश्यमान रखने के लिए FixedData को True सेट करें

मैं इस मुद्दे को कैसे तय किया था, मैन्युअल रूप से मैं मैन्युअल रूप से कोड बदल गया था (मेनू देखें / कोड से) नीचे दिए गए अनुभाग में कई संख्याओं की संख्या होनी चाहिए <TablixMember> </TablixMember> रूप में पंक्तियों की संख्या <TablixMember> </TablixMember> में है मेरे मामले में मेरे पास <TablixMember> </TablixMember> में पंक्तियों की संख्या की तुलना में अधिक जोड़े <TablixMember> </TablixMember> थे इसके अलावा, अगर आप "उन्नत मोड" ("कॉलम समूह" के दाएं) पर जाते हैं, तो "पंक्ति समूह" के पीछे की स्थिर पंक्तियों की संख्या टैब्लिकिक्स में पंक्तियों की संख्या के बराबर होनी चाहिए। इसे बराबर बनाने का तरीका कोड बदल रहा है।

 <TablixRowHierarchy> <TablixMembers> <TablixMember> <KeepWithGroup>After</KeepWithGroup> <RepeatOnNewPage>true</RepeatOnNewPage> </TablixMember> <TablixMember> <Group Name="Detail" /> </TablixMember> </TablixMembers> </TablixRowHierarchy> 

मेरे लिए क्या काम किया गया था, स्क्रैच से एक नई रिपोर्ट तैयार करना।

यह किया और काम करने वाली नई रिपोर्ट, मैं दृश्य स्टूडियो में 2 .rdl फ़ाइलों की तुलना करूँगा। ये एक्सएमएल प्रारूप में हैं और मैं एक त्वरित विंडडिफ की उम्मीद कर रहा हूं या कुछ बताएगा कि यह मुद्दा क्या था।

एक प्रारंभिक रूप से पता चलता है कि दोनों फाइलों में 700 लाइनें कोड या थोड़ी अधिक अंतर है, जिनमें से 2 में दोषपूर्ण फ़ाइल होती है TablixHeader टैग पर एक सरसरी देखो कुछ स्पष्ट नहीं प्रकट किया था।

लेकिन मेरे मामले में यह भ्रष्ट .rdl फाइल थी यह मूल रूप से एक कार्यशील रिपोर्ट से कॉपी की गई थी, इसलिए इसे फिर से उपयोग न करने की प्रक्रिया में, यह इसे भ्रष्ट कर सकता था हालांकि, अन्य रिपोर्ट्स जहां यह एक ही प्रक्रिया हुई थी, शीर्षकों को दोहरा सकते हैं जब गुणों में सही सेटिंग्स बनाई गई थी।

उम्मीद है की यह मदद करेगा। यदि आपको एक जटिल रिपोर्ट मिल गई है, यह त्वरित सुधार नहीं है, लेकिन यह काम करता है

शायद आपके अंत में दोषपूर्ण लोगों को ज्ञात अच्छी XML फाइलों की तुलना करना एक अच्छा मंच पोस्ट बना देगा मैं अपने अंत में कोशिश कर रहा हूँ